Mexico, ca. 19th Century CE. A colorful antique Mexican retablo depicting El Alma de Maria, or the Soul of Mary. Icons like these were placed above household altars to venerate the saints (retablo literally means "behind the altar"). The retablo became wildly popular in the 19th century due to the introduction of tin as an affordable medium. This example shows the Holy Ghost in the form of a dove descending on the Virgin Mary to announce the Incarnation. She smiles sweetly as the dove hovers above her folded hands. Rods of roses and daisies extend from her arms, and the scene is set against a brilliant blue background. 14" x 9 3/4"
